Cats: An Anthology of Stories and Poems

Angebote / Angebote:

A wonderful selection of writing on cats, from Aesop to Oscar Wilde, and from ancient Egypt to twentieth-century New YorkFrom beautiful lyrics to madcap waggery, from the prime suspect in a partridge killing in ancient Greece to the medieval monk's cat Pangur Bán and encompassing odes, fables, stories, limericks songs, nursery rhymes and more, Mark Bryant has compiled a wonderfully evocative collection of writing of all kinds on cats by those who love them. There are poems from Chaucer, Baudelaire, Emily Dickinson, Thomas Hardy, Christina Rosetti, Keats, Shelley and Wordsworth, humorous pieces by Lewis Carroll, Ambrose Bierce, Edward Lear and Jerome K. Jerome, and other delights from writers such as Edgar Allan Poe, Saki and Mark Twain. Covering every genre, from humour and fantasy to romance and horror, and drawn from every part of the world, these stories, poems and excerpts from essays, letters, diaries and journals provide a collection to delight any cat-lover.'An ideal Christmas buy'Guardian
